在现代的数据管理中,了解如何查询数据库中的字段数量是一个基本而重要的技能。无论您是数据分析师、软件开发人员还是数据库管理员,掌握这一技能都能提高您的工作效率并帮助您更好地管理数据。
什么是字段?
在数据库中,字段是表格中用于存储信息的基本单位。每个字段都有特定的数据类型,并且这些字段共同组成了一条记录。例如,在一个用户信息表中,姓名、邮箱和电话号码都是字段。
为何需要查询字段数量?
查询字段数量在以下几种情况下特别有用:
- 了解数据结构:在新的项目中,快速掌握数据库表的字段数量和类型,能帮助您更好地理解数据模式。
- 优化查询:通过了解哪些字段可用,您可以构建出更高效的数据库查询,提升数据处理性能。
- 维护数据完整性:监控字段数量的变化可以帮助您发现潜在的数据问题,如字段缺失或多余。
如何查询字段数量?
查询字段的数量,通常使用数据库查询语言,如SQL。这里我们将介绍如何在不同的数据库管理系统中执行这一操作。
1. 在MySQL中查询字段数量
在MySQL中,您可以使用以下SQL语句:
SELECT COUNT(*)
FROM INFORMATION_SCHEMA.COLUMNS
WHERE TABLE_NAME = 'your_table_name';
将其中的your_table_name替换为您要查询的表名。这条语句会返回指定表中的字段数量。
2. 在PostgreSQL中查询字段数量
在PostgreSQL中,可以使用类似的查询:
SELECT COUNT(*)
FROM information_schema.columns
WHERE table_name = 'your_table_name';
同样,请将your_table_name替换为您目标表的名称。
3. 在SQL Server中查询字段数量
在SQL Server中,您可以使用以下语句:
SELECT COUNT(*)
FROM INFORMATION_SCHEMA.COLUMNS
WHERE TABLE_NAME = 'your_table_name';
这条语句有效地统计了指定表中的字段数量。
4. 在Oracle中查询字段数量
在Oracle数据库中,您需要使用另外一种方式:
SELECT COUNT(*)
FROM user_tab_columns
WHERE table_name = 'YOUR_TABLE_NAME';
确保在查询前将表名改成大写。
处理查询结果
无论您使用哪种数据库,查询的结果都将告诉您表中各种字段的数量。理解结果后,您可以开始进行更深入的数据分析或数据迁移工作。
常见问题解答
如何处理没有字段的表?
如果表中没有字段,查询结果将返回0。您可以根据业务需要决定是否创建相应的字段。
是否可以通过其他工具来查看字段数量?
是的,许多数据库管理工具(如phpMyAdmin或SQL Server Management Studio)都提供图形化界面,允许您直接查看每个表的字段信息和数量。
总结
通过本文,您已经学习了如何在各种数据库系统中查询字段数量,我们希望这对您的工作有所帮助。掌握这一技能后,您将在数据管理中更加得心应手。
感谢您阅读这篇文章,希望您能从中获得实用信息,提升您的数据库操作能力。
- 相关评论
- 我要评论
-